Recognizing Regulatory Requirements for Financial Advisors in Iowa, IA

Licensing and Registration

Financial advisors in Iowa, IA, are required to become licensed and registered with the Iowa Insurance Division or the Iowa Securities Bureau, depending on the specific financial products they offer. The licensing and registration process involves meeting certain educational, examination, and experience requirements, along with submitting the necessary documentation and fees. The Iowa Insurance Division oversees the regulation of insurance agents, whereas the Iowa Securities Bureau regulates investment advisors and broker-dealers. Advisors must adhere to the specific rules and regulations set forth by these regulatory bodies to maintain their licenses and registrations.

Continuing Education

In addition to initial licensing requirements, financial advisors in Iowa, IA, are also required to fulfill continuing education (CE) credits to maintain their licenses. The Iowa Insurance Division and the Iowa Securities Bureau mandate that advisors complete a certain number of CE hours within specific timeframes. These CE requirements are designed to ensure that advisors stay updated on industry trends, regulations, and best practices. Failure to comply with CE requirements can result in the suspension or revocation of a financial advisor’s license.

Compliance Oversight and Record-Keeping

Financial advisory firms in Iowa, IA, must establish robust compliance oversight processes to monitor and track the licenses and credentials of their advisors. This includes keeping accurate records of the licenses held by each advisor, renewal dates, CE completion, and any disciplinary actions or complaints. Firms must also maintain comprehensive documentation to demonstrate compliance with regulatory requirements during audits and examinations by regulatory authorities.
